Who is the Dark Archer?
Arrow: The Dark Archer brings readers the man behind the.....villain (you thought I was going to say "mask," didn't you?!) or should it be the villain behind the man? Whichever way you spin it, John Barrowman's Malcolm Merlyn is a complex guy. You don't even know how complex until you get comfy with a copy of this graphic novel by both John and Carole Barrowman.Malcolm Merlyn is just one iteration of this character. He's been known by several names and one in the novel that is not familiar to me - Arthur King. In this adaption we learn who Arthur King is and how he became involved in a secret organization, crossing paths with supernatural creatures and with the League of Assassins. The history he reveals at the hands of his captors pulls pieces together, answers questions, and allows the reader to get to know the The Dark Archer.Written in the same tone and with the same sass that John Barrowman portrays with Merlyn, you'll feel like you're in an Arrow spin-off. I found the entire graphic novel to be written well while providing much needed backstory for our beloved antihero. I have a love-hate relationship with Merlyn, and The Dark Archer doesn't improve that relationship..haha.The Barrowman's did a fantastic job writing Malcolm Merlyn's history, giving fans of the character more information about the character. The artistry was also fantastic. Each panel is clearly drawn and the speech and though balloons are easily discernible from character to character. There is action, adventure, wit, and danger in this fast-paced look into The Dark Archer.I purchased my review copy.

If your a fan of Arrow then your going to love this!
This book serves as a companion to the tv series Arrow. It fills in the backstory of series regular Malcolm Merlyn. What is really cool about this book however is that its written by John Barrowman (the actor who plays Malcolm in the show) and his sister Carole. The story itself is fast paced and adds a bit more depth to the Arrow universe. The art in the book is great and really brings the story to life!

Good One
I have read Flash Season Zero and Arrow Season 2.5 before reading this. All these graphic novels have almost equal number of pages but flash had 7 stories while arrow 2.5 had 3 stories. The stories in arrow 2.5 were still better connected than flash's. In this book there's only one story so obviously plot expansion and depth is much more than rest two books. I like the plot as well as the narration, it was heartening to see that John Barrowman is so connected to his role that he tried to explore his character furthermore. This is basically Arrow season 3.5 along with few flashbacks of Merlyn's past (before he came to Starling City). The story fits reasonably OK with the show. No doubt Malcolm Merlyn's character has more dimensions/shades than any other in the Arrow TV Series and this story provides another. Artwork throughout the pages is quite good and the coloring is exceptional, specially in the flashback sequences. Overall a good read for the TV series as well as graphic novel fans.
